Charlie le Mindu live @ SHOWstudio

Famed for his work with Lady GaGa and his amazing fusion of fashion/millinery/hairdressing , Charlie le Mindu is sure to excite when he sets to work tomorrow at the SHOWstudio space. Webcams will be streaming his every move live on 11th and 12th March 2010, giving us a chance to see the avante-garde hair stylist at work. The brief? Diamonds, religion, and 'bigger than anything attempted before…'

FACEHUNTER: the book

I know, I know, another book - my addiction is getting out of control - I may need to seek professional help soon! Usually I go for large, coffee table tomes but the latest addition to me ever-growing fashion library is a perfectly man-bag sized gem from blogging royalty - Face Hunter. The Sartorialist had a book, and now does the Face Hunter...but if I had only enough space for one on my bowing bookcase, I'd have to opt for Yvan Rodic's sharp observations of innovative personal style;

'Face Hunter travels the globe in search of the most inventive, colourful, freaky, imaginative, gifted, graceful, exquisite, fascinating, unpredictable, gorgeous, refined, delicate, divine, facehuntable, fantabulous, bewitching, edgy, ravishing, chic, winning, alluring, wild, glamorous, voluptuous, radiant and classy.'

'I'm not a social scientist or a journalist...My pictures are not meant to document reality; they are meant to tell you short stories.' FaceHunter

I didn't even realise this image was from Face Hunter until I saw it in the book - one of my favourite images of both Roisin Murphy and this iconic Pugh dress (certainly looks better than when Beyonce tried to Pull-off-a-Pugh!).

Sonny Groo looking fierce as usual, contrasting against this luxurious tangerine drapery illustrate both extremes of my taste radar. Simply delicious.

This is my favourite shot. Or is it my favourite outfit? Or is the boy just cute? Who knows, but I love that freekin' jacket!

To launch his book Yvan Rodic (aka FaceHunter) is holding a book signing at Foyles, Charing Cross Road on 12th March, at 5pm. BE THERE.
